ALSO HOW TO DRIED, CLEAN AND PRESERVED IT.VERY EASY DIY … Web2 okt. 2013 · Vinegar contains acetic acid, weak enough for humans to consume but strong enough to kill moss. To use, simply pour white vinegar directly on the moss and let sit for 30 minutes. Rinse or scrape the moss away. WebHere’s a quick step-by-step guide for how to remove moss and green algae from a wood deck: Step 1: Make your cleaning solution. Fill a bucket with one gallon of warm water and ¾ cup of chlorine bleach.
